Key AI-Powered Features
Content-Aware Fill
Seamlessly removes unwanted elements from video frames by analyzing surrounding pixels. Maintains footage integrity while streamlining editing processes.
Machine Learning Animation
AI suggests animations and helps interpolate frames automatically. Creates smoother transitions and enhances complex sequences with minimal manual input.
AI-Enhanced Rotoscoping Process
Apply Roto Brush Tool
Use color similarity detection to select video elements, simplifying frame-by-frame tasks
Machine Learning Prediction
AI learns from previous selections and intelligently predicts rotoscoped areas in complex scenes
Automated Refinement
Algorithms minimize manual adjustments and achieve smoother, more accurate masks

Content-Aware Fill Workflow
Element Identification
Specify unwanted elements in video compositions using effective masking techniques
AI Analysis
Algorithm analyzes neighboring pixels and evaluates movement and lighting changes
Intelligent Fill
System infers appropriate content to fill gaps, maintaining visual coherence
